Kayaking Dry Creek: Exploring a Tranquil Oasis in Louisiana's Heart
Nestled in the heart of Louisiana, Dry Creek offers a serene and picturesque paddling experience for kayakers of all skill levels. This gentle, slow-moving stream, spanning through the Avoyelles Parish, presents a unique opportunity for nature enthusiasts, photographers, and those seeking a peaceful day on the water.
Dry Creek is part of a broader network of waterways that crisscross the Louisiana landscape, providing a variety of paddling experiences for both locals and visitors. The state's mild climate and diverse aquatic ecosystems make it a popular destination for kayaking and canoeing, with numerous creeks, rivers, and bayous offering a range of difficulty levels and scenic backdrops.

helpFrequently Asked Questions
help_outlineWhere can I launch my kayak on Dry Creek?
You can launch your kayak at the Hooker Hole Boat Ramp, which provides free public access to the creek.
help_outlineWhat skill level is Dry Creek suitable for?
Dry Creek is considered a calm, easy stream, making it suitable for beginner and intermediate kayakers.
help_outlineWhat gear should I bring for kayaking Dry Creek?
Essential gear includes a life jacket, paddle, and any personal flotation devices. You may also want to bring sun protection, water, and a small cooler.
help_outlineCan I fish from my kayak on Dry Creek?
Yes, you can fish on Dry Creek, but you'll need a valid fishing license as per standard state regulations.
help_outlineWhat is the best season for kayaking Dry Creek?
The best season for kayaking Dry Creek is spring through fall, when the water levels are typically higher and the weather is more favorable.
help_outlineIs there parking available at the Hooker Hole Boat Ramp?
Yes, the Hooker Hole Boat Ramp provides free public parking for kayakers and other boaters accessing Dry Creek.
help_outlineIs Dry Creek family-friendly for kayaking?
Yes, Dry Creek is considered a family-friendly option for kayaking due to its calm waters and lack of motorboat traffic.
